🔔 Emergency Support & Mental Health

📞 Emergency Services – 112
If you or someone else is in immediate danger (violence, injury, imminent threat), call 112 right away for police, ambulance or fire services.

📞 Supportline 179
Call 179 (free from landline and mobile) — available 24/7.
This national helpline provides immediate emotional support, guidance and referral to appropriate services, and can help connect you to specialists depending on your situation (e.g., domestic violence, crisis, loneliness).

🌐 Kellimni.com – Online Support
https://www.kellimni.com
A confidential online chat support platform where trained listeners offer emotional support and a safe space to talk, anytime.

🧡 Domestic & Gender-Based Violence Support

Agenzija Appogg – Domestic Violence Unit
https://fsws.gov.mt/domestic-violence-unit/
📞 +356 2295 9000
Part of the Foundation for Social Welfare Services, this team of social workers assists people affected by domestic or gender-based violence, helping with risk assessment, safety planning, immediate aid and ongoing support.

Victim Support Malta (VSM)
https://victimsupport.org.mt/
📞 +356 2122 8333
An NGO that supports victims of crime, including domestic violence, sexual assault, harassment and discrimination. They offer emotional support, counselling, legal information, liaison with authorities, personalised care and therapeutic services.

⚖️ Legal Rights & Advocacy

Women’s Rights Foundation (WRF)
https://www.wrf.org.mt/
📞 Free Legal Helpline: 80062149 (Mondays, Wednesdays & Fridays, usually 2pm–6pm)
WRF provides free legal advice and information for women facing gender-based violence, discrimination, sexual harm, unequal treatment and related legal concerns. They also engage in education and empowerment around rights.

🤝 Additional Community Support

SOAR Malta (St Jeanne Antide Foundation)

https://www.facebook.com/soarservice/
A survivor-led support group for women affected by domestic abuse, offering emotional support, shared community experience, mentoring and empowerment.

Caritas Malta
https://www.caritasmalta.org/
A social welfare organisation offering outreach services, community support, counselling referrals and assistance in various kinds of hardship or transition. Offeres community services in relation to alcohol and drug abuse. They also provide support to others in need including the homeless, victims of usury, the elderly, people with HIV and Aids and people with epilepsy.
